On 22/11/2006 at 6:40 PM, Ernest Schaal <email@hidden> wrote:

[...]

I dragged the "MyCoolApp Help" folder into the Xcode project manager, under
Resources, and at the dialog box selected "Copy items into destination
group's folder (if needed)," using the Reference Type of Default and using
the Text Encoding of Western (Mac OS Roman). I selected "Recursively create
groups for any added folders" and added to the target "RandomApp."

When I build the application, the Help never works.

Unlike the "SimpleCocoaApp," I notice that the folder is not in the Product
contents. The index.html file and the MyCoolAppHelp.helpindex is there, but
not the folder itself.

What am I doing wrong?

When you drag the folder into your Xcode project under Resources, choose "Create Folder References for any added folders" instead. That should fix it.
